"With the new upheaval of Beatle love lately (Beatles Rock Band, remastered songs, etc.) I realized that I didn't know that much about the actual history of, probably, the most famous band...ever. The gf, who is obsessed with them, said this was her favorite bio of them, so I checked it out. In the end, I did learn alot about the men behind the mania, but it did leave me sometimes wanting more.
The biography follows the fab 4, as well as those close to them (Cynthia Lennon, Brian Epstein, etc) through the 60s, from their childhoods all the way till John's death. Since Steven Gaines and Peter Brown actually knew the Beatles, it was very interesting to hear so many of the background stories and truth to what was going on behind the scenes.
My few qualms with it where I was sometimes frustrated with what was being concentrated on and what was getting glossed over. For example, since Peter Brown was heavily involved in the Beatles finances, there are a few long sections where the exact numbers are crunched. While interesting at first, these quickly become boring and frustrating when 15+ pages are dedicated to various lawsuits and contracts with record companies, where huge moments like the Ed Sullivan show, Shea Stadium, even their last concert on the rooftop are just quickly mentioned and passed over. But I guess you write what you know.
Overall, this was an enjoyable read if you want to really know what it was like for the 4 during their insane run. But it is really only part of the picture."
